Onboarding note for the Ledgerpane admin table: bulk edits are applied through the batcher service, not directly against the database. Select rows, choose an action, and the batcher stages changes in a pending set you can review before commit. Edits over 500 rows require a second approver — this is enforced server-side, so don't try to chunk around it. To run the batcher locally you need the staging write credential, which goes in your .env as the next line.

secret setting of bahip-kagag: RELAY_SECRET3=c83

Scope: verify the 2 p.m. cutoff rule for next-day custom orders at Crumbwright Bakery's online storefront. Cases: order at 13:59 accepted for tomorrow; 14:00 exactly rejected; 14:01 rejected with correct messaging; timezone handling for the Dunmere and Saltgate branches; DST boundary day. Edge case: cart created before cutoff, submitted after — must reject. Automated suite runs against the staging order service nightly. Reviewer: confirm assertions match spec rev 7. Staging API calls authenticate with the token below.

portal login ticket: eyJhbGciOiJIUzI1NiIsInR5cCI6IkpXVCJ9.eyJzdWIiOiI0Z4ywpUMsBIn0.ca5FVhkdBXa3

Subject: Ownership change — Brindle image cache leak

Plugin authors: the memory leak in Brindle's image cache (unreleased decoded bitmaps under rapid eviction) has a new owner effective Monday. A patched cache with hard memory caps ships in 2.8.1; please retest plugins that hold image references. Report regressions through the tracker. All cache-related issues should now be assigned to the engineer named below.

account owner for bawip-tahag: Raleth Quenok

Ticket: Staging env misconfigured for Siftgate bloom filter

The bloom layer in front of the Pellet KV store is rejecting all lookups in staging because the env file was copied from the dev template without credentials. False-positive tuning values are fine; only the auth line is missing. To unblock the weekly demo, the Pellet admission secret must be set on the following line.

env line for yaguf-fajop: LEDGER_TOKEN13=fb08984397349